Command Of The Seas: Building The 600 Ship Navy (1988) By John F. Lehman, Jr.
After six years in the Reagan administration John F. Lehman, Jr., writes his personal memoirs--about his life at the National Security Council, his career at the Arms Control and Disarmament Agency, his war experiences as a pilot in Vietnam, and his career in the Reagan administration where, as Secretary of the Navy, Lehman was instrumental in creating the most formidable navy of all time
